(b) Within-Subject Two Way Anova :-  A within-subjects design is an experiment in which the same group of subjects serves in more than one treatment. Note that I'm using the word "treatment" to refer to levels of the independent variable, rather than "group".So it is Within -Subject Two Way Anova.

Mixed- Factorial Two -Way Anova:-  A mixed factorial Two Way Anova involves two or more independent variables, of which at least one is a within-subjects (repeated measures) factor and at least one is a between-groups factor. In the simplest case, there will be one between-groups factor and one within-subjects factor.

Example:- if we are interested in examining the effects of a new type of cognitive therapy on depression, we would give a depression pre-test to a group of persons diagnosed as clinically depressed and randomly assign them into two groups (traditional and cognitive therapy). After the patients were treated according to their assigned condition for some period of time, say a month, they would be given a measure of depression again (post-test). This design would consist of one within subject variable (test), with two levels (pre and post), and one between subjects variable (therapy), with two levels (traditional and cognitive).
